mother-child relationships in adolescence and adulthood
Definition
- Throughout adolescence and into adulthood, mothers' relationships with their children grow more distant. They spend less time together, and children turn to other social ties (e.g., friends, romantic partners) for many supportive and social functions. [Source: Encyclopedia of Human Relationships; Mother-Child Relationships in Adolescence and Adulthood]
